Hotel backup power must support guest rooms, elevators, kitchens, air conditioning, water systems, security and the front desk, with particular attention to quiet nighttime transfer, fuel runtime, noise control and service response.
Core Risk
A hotel outage immediately affects room lighting, door locks, front-desk systems, elevators, water supply, kitchens and security. The design must balance noise, exhaust, nighttime transfer, load priorities and fuel runtime so one outage does not turn into widespread complaints and refunds.

Read TopicCritical-load priorities
Fire and security systems, emergency lighting, the front desk, access and locks, network core, evacuation elevators, critical pumps and essential room circuits.
Kitchens and cold rooms, critical food-service equipment, selected guest-room cooling, public lighting, hot water and parking systems.
Whole-building comfort cooling, decorative banquet lighting, noncritical outlets and selected back-of-house equipment, subject to capacity and runtime.
System Configuration Guidance
Prioritize the acoustic enclosure, generator location, exhaust, ventilation, service access and distance from guest rooms.
Define critical circuits, transfer time, manual bypass and test procedures to minimize guest awareness.
Zone guest rooms, the lobby, kitchens, telecom and safety systems to control capacity and fuel cost.
Confirm the day tank, fuel alarms, refueling path, operating hours and hotel restrictions.
Use remote inspection to monitor generator status, alarms, ATS condition, operating hours and maintenance reminders.
Define local inspection and after-sales support according to city, hotel category, site-access rules and spare-parts needs.
